Application of ANN in Hydraulic Pressure Control Fault Diagnosis System
The existing hydraulic pressure control fault diagnosis system is effective on fault detection,but the fault isolation capability is bad.In order to improve the capability of the fault isolation,the artificial neural network (ANN) is used in the fault diagnosis system.Aimed at the representative diagnosis of the hydraulic pressure control system,the three layers feedback network is adopted,the basic theory of conjugate gradient BP neural network is explained in detail,and the key techniques are introduced.Five types of typical faults of hydraulic pressure control system can be distinguished easily by it,the faults diagnosis efficiency is higher 30% than ever and the fault diagnosis capability is better 80% than before.
